Aijiren™ reagent bottles, also called media bottles, are manufactured from high-quality, borosilicate 3.3 glass, with a GL45 thread cap. With their superior chemical resistance, these bottles are ideal for the storage of reagents, culture media, biological fluids, and a variety of other aqueous and non-aqueous solutions.
